Richard Andrews was born in Kilsby, Northamptonshire, England, United Kingdom in 1404, to John Andrews and Joan Wells. Later in life, Richard Andrews married Catherine Burbeck; among their children were John Andrews, Edward Andrews, Thomas Andrews, Anthony Andrews, James Andrews, Andrew Andrews, William Andrew, Mary Andrews and Catherine Andrew. Richard Andrews died in Kilsby, Northamptonshire, England, United Kingdom, 1450.
